Cage system and chip management system
A cage is divided into a plurality of locations, including a cashier room. The gaming chip has an RFID tag storing a chip ID. The cage system that manages the movement of the gaming chips within the cage of the casino hall comprises: a chip reader that reads a chip ID from an RFID tag of a gaming chip moving between multiple locations within the cage; a chip reader that reads the chip ID from the RFID tag of the gaming chips that exit the cage to the casino hall; and a chip management database that records the chip IDs read by the chip reader as the movement history of the gaming chips.
1 . A management system for managing gaming chip credits within a casino, wherein a plurality of gaming tables as sources of transfer of the credits are provided on the floor of the casino for storing gaming chips that increase or decrease as a result of game liquidation,
each of the plurality of gaming tables is assigned a table ID,
a cage is provided outside the casino floor as a destination of transfer of the credits, and
the gaming chip is assigned a chip ID,
the management system comprises:
a memory device configured to store the number of gaming chips that increase or decrease in each of the plurality of gaming tables;
a chip management device configured to refer to the memory device and issue a notification to the gaming tables in which the number of the gaming chips is greater than or equal to a predetermined number, wherein the notification prompts the credit;
a table chip reader provided at each of the plurality of gaming tables to read the chip IDs of the gaming chips to be transferred from the gaming tables to the destination in response to obtaining the notification; and
a transfer source management device provided at each of the plurality of gaming tables, which outputs the chip IDs of the gaming chips read by a respective table chip reader and the table ID of a respective gaming table in which the chip IDs were read to the chip management device.
2 . The management system according to claim 1 , wherein the memory device is configured to store a transferring history for each chip ID,
the chip management device is configured to update the transferring history for the chip ID in response to receiving the chip ID and the table ID from the transfer source management device.
